U-Boot part of Lite5200b low power mode support.
Puts SDRAM out of self-refresh and transfers control to
address saved at physical 0x0.

On 26/03/07 10:08 -0600, Grant Likely wrote:
> On 3/15/07, Domen Puncer <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> >U-Boot part of Lite5200b low power mode support.
> >Puts SDRAM out of self-refresh and transfers control to
> >address saved at physical 0x0.
> 
> This looks pretty straight forward.
> 
> My only comment is that psc2_4 is probably used as GPIO instead of
> power control by some users (The lite5200 is an eval board after all).
> Maybe wrap the code with #ifdef CONFIG_LITE5200B_PM (instead of
> CONFIG_LITE5200B) so that it can be easily compiled out.
> 
> Also, '//' style comments should be changed to '/* */'
> 
> Otherwise;
> Acked-by: Grant Likely <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>

+
+#ifdef CONFIG_LITE5200B_PM
+/* u-boot part of low-power mode implementation */
+#define SAVED_ADDR (*(void **)0x00000000)
+#define PSC2_4 0x02
+
+void lite5200b_wakeup(void)
+{
+       unsigned char wakeup_pin;
+       void (*linux_wakeup)(void);
+
+       /* check PSC2_4, if it's down "QT" is signaling we have a wakeup
+        * from low power mode */
+       *(vu_char *)MPC5XXX_WU_GPIO_ENABLE = PSC2_4;
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+
+       wakeup_pin = *(vu_char *)MPC5XXX_WU_GPIO_DATA_I;
+       if (wakeup_pin & PSC2_4)
+               return;
+
+       /* acknowledge to "QT"
+        * by holding pin at 1 for 10 uS */
+       *(vu_char *)MPC5XXX_WU_GPIO_DIR = PSC2_4;
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+       *(vu_char *)MPC5XXX_WU_GPIO_DATA_O = PSC2_4;
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+       udelay(10);
+
+       /* put ram out of self-refresh */
+       *(vu_long *)MPC5XXX_SDRAM_CTRL |= 0x80000000;   /* mode_en */
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+       *(vu_long *)MPC5XXX_SDRAM_CTRL |= 0x50000000;   /* cke ref_en */
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+       *(vu_long *)MPC5XXX_SDRAM_CTRL &= ~0x80000000;  /* !mode_en */
+       __asm__ volatile ("sync");
+       udelay(10); /* wait a bit */
+
+       /* jump back to linux kernel code */
+       linux_wakeup = SAVED_ADDR;
+       printf("\n\nLooks like we just woke, transferring control to 0x%08lx\n",
+                       linux_wakeup);
+       linux_wakeup();
+}
+#else
+#define lite5200b_wakeup()
+#endif
